WebDifferential Equations of Form dy/dx = f (x) or f (y) (1) Differential Equations of Form dy/dx = f (x) To solve this type of differential equations we integrate both sides to obtain the general solution as discussed below. WebEven and Odd Functions. They are special types of functions. Even Functions. A function is "even" when: f(x) = f(−x) for all x In other words there is symmetry about the y-axis (like a reflection):. This is the curve f(x) = x 2 +1. They got called "even" functions because the functions x 2, x 4, x 6, x 8, etc behave like that, but there are other functions that behave …
